Nicolas Roa is a 32-year-old football player who plays as a midfielder for Tigres FC, born on February 24, 1994, who is right-footed. Follow Nicolas Roa on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
Nicolas Roa's next match is on March 11, 2026 when Tigres FC face Bogota FC in the Primera B Apertura.

Nicolas Roa's career has also included time at Tigres FC, Bucaramanga, Deportivo Pasto, Independiente Yumbo, Santa Fe, Deportivo Cali, and Llaneros FC.

Throughout their career, Nicolas Roa has won 1 title: Cuadrangular Pereira (2018) with Deportivo Cali.
